Frans-Paul van der Putten
banner
franspaulvdputten.bsky.social
Frans-Paul van der Putten
@franspaulvdputten.bsky.social
Independent analyst and founder, ChinaGeopolitics - Author of 'China Resurrected: A Modern Geopolitical History'
No videos yet.